Discover the PA-120Net 120W Networked Power Amplifier, a state-of-the-art audio solution designed to deliver exceptional sound quality and versatility for professional AV installations. This high-performance amplifier is engineered to seamlessly switch between high-impedance (Hi-Z) at 70V/100V and low-impedance (Lo-Z) at 4 Ohms/8 Ohms, catering to a diverse array of loudspeaker configurations.
The PA-120Net stands out with its balanced and unbalanced input options, providing the flexibility to connect a variety of audio sources. Additionally, the unit boasts a balanced stereo line-level output, expanding its utility in complex audio setups. The integration of a Dante interface revolutionizes audio networking, allowing for pristine digital signal transmission across a local area network using standard internet protocols, making it an ideal choice for scalable audio systems.
Equipped with advanced built-in DSP (Digital Signal Processing), the PA-120Net ensures a flat frequency response and superior sonic performance. The amplifier's excellent signal-to-noise ratio and exceptionally low distortion levels guarantee that audio is reproduced with clarity and precision.
The PA-120Net's adaptability is further enhanced by its ability to deliver 1 channel of 120W into a 70V/100V line or 2 channels of 60W into 4 Ohms/8 Ohms, making it suitable for a wide range of loudspeaker installations. Each output channel supports an independent input mix, complete with master volume control, a 3-band parametric EQ, and a selectable high-pass filter. This allows for tailored audio output that can be optimized for different environments, whether for live venue sound reinforcement or recording purposes.
Professional-grade signal conversion technology is at the heart of the PA-120Net, featuring the latest generation 32-bit advanced Digital Analog Converter architecture. This ensures excellent dynamic performance and improved tolerance to clock jitter, maintaining the integrity of the original audio signal with selectable sampling rates up to 96 kHz.
Durability and reliability are paramount in the design of the PA-120Net. The amplifier is fortified with multiple layers of protection against over-current, DC voltage at the outputs, high-frequency interference, and overheating. Intelligent, heat-sensitive fans provide additional safeguarding, ensuring the amplifier operates efficiently under various conditions.
Flexible control options are available for the PA-120Net, including local management via RS-232 serial commands or remote operation through embedded web pages over Ethernet. This provides users with the convenience of adjusting settings from different locations.
Energy efficiency is another key feature of the PA-120Net, which includes an auto-standby function for power-saving operation. Users can customize the noise floor threshold to determine the precise conditions under which the amplifier enters sleep mode and when it should reactivate, optimizing power usage and reducing operational costs.
Installation of the PA-120Net is straightforward, with its half 19" size allowing for mounting in a 1U rack space using the recommended rack adapter. This compact form factor makes it an unobtrusive addition to any professional audio setup.
